Athletics News
The Oakland Athletics suffered a frustrating 6-4 loss to the Seattle Mariners in front of a record-breaking crowd of 10,876 at Spring Training, as they blew a late lead with just a week left until the season opener. Despite the disappointing outcome, manager Mark Kotsay announced that Luis Severino will take the mound on Opening Day against the Blue Jays, a decision that brings excitement and high hopes for the 2026 season. As the A’s look to shake off the spring rust, there's also buzz surrounding Max Muncy, who might be poised for a breakout year, following the footsteps of rising stars like Brent Rooker and Tyler Soderstrom. With mixed results on the field, the A's are balancing optimism and urgency as they prepare for the challenges ahead.
